Contact of cryogenic liquid with skin will cause severe frostbite. Light skin blisters, swelling, pain; heavy will freeze the internal tissue and bone joints. If it falls into the eye, it will cause eye damage. Therefore, when discharging the liquid, avoid direct contact with the liquid by hand, and wear dry cotton gloves and protective glasses when necessary. In case of contact with the skin, should immediately wash with warm water (below 45 ℃).After the air compressor stopped automatically, the pressure in the air cooling tower decreased, and when the air compressor was started again, the molecular sieve purifier water inflow accident occurred. Liquid air separation plant liquid hub area piping arrangement is mainly oxygen, nitrogen, argon liquid pipeline and pump box in the liquid pipeline arrangement. As oxygen, nitrogen, argon liquid temperature is extremely low (liquid oxygen -183 ° C ℃, liquid nitrogen -196 ° C, argon liquid -185.7C), in the liquid flow process, resulting in a certain amount of gasification, piping should pay attention to the slope of the liquid pipeline towards (no slope requirements on the process). Air cooling column is a mixed heat exchange device. The function is to make the cooling water fully contact with the air and being mixed fully to increase the heat transfer area and enhance the heat transfer, usually using "packed column" or "sieve plate". The packed column is a round steel container with packing (ceramic ring, plastic ring, etc.). Cooling water is ejected from the top of the column and mixed with air flowing upward from the bottom for heat and mass exchange. Air transfers heat to the cooling water, lowering its temperature and raising its temperature. In order to prevent the generation of water droplets in the air, the raschig ring (or stainless steel wire mesh) packing separator (also known as trapping layer) and mechanical water separator (inertial separation) are usually installed on the upper part of the column.
